PURPOSE:To improve the efficiency of the solar heat collector by a method wherein a fin made of a shape memory material is closely fixed to a heat collecting tube placed on a line passing through the focussing point of a parabolically surfaced troughlike concave mirror and is made to store a configuration pattern according to which the fin lies parallel or normal to the optical axis of the mirror when the temperature of the fin becomes higher or lower than a predetermined value. CONSTITUTION:The heat collecting tube 2 is so set that it comes to lie at a position on a line passing through the optical axis A of the parabolically surfaced troughlike concave mirror. The tube 2 is sealed within a glass pipe 3 and the fin 4 made of a shape memory material is closely fixed to the tube 2. The fin 4 is made to store the configuration pattern according to which the fin comes to the fin comes to lie parallel to the optical axis A of the concave mirror when the temperature of the fin 4 becomes higher than the predetermined value but it comes to extend normal to the optical axis A when the temperature thereof becomes lower than the predetermined value. Thus, when the direct sunlight is obtained, the fin 4 comes to lie parallel to the optical axis A so that the collection of the sunlight by the concave mirror is not obstructed but when otherwise, the fin is held stretched to thereby receive the sunlight in a scattered condition. |
